Every day I get the following from SBE 2012:
(Server: "") Backup Exec found 5 servers without an Agent for Windows installed. To back up the servers, you must add them to the list of servers on the Backup and Restore tab. Click Add in the Servers group, then click Next. Confirm that you want to establish a trust with the server or servers, then click Next. Click Browse, then expand All Servers. Expand Servers without an Agent for Windows installed to locate the server.
Symantec - if I wanted an agent on any additional servers, I would deploy one. I have one on all systems that I back up.
How can I get rid of this annoying email?

By default, the data discovery operation runs at noon every day. It also runs each time the Backup Exec services are restarted. Backup Exec cancels the operation if it is still running after four hours. You can disable the operation in the global Backup Exec settings.
